Abstract
An optical reader comprising: an image sensor array for converting light from a target into output signals representative thereof, the image sensor array having a centerline; a processor for decoding a machine readable symbology within the target derived from the output signals; receive optics for directing light from the target to the image sensor, the optics having a receive optics optical axis, wherein the image sensor array and receive optics are configured such that the centerline is not coincident with the optical axis.

18. An optical reader for imaging a target disposed in a plane comprising:
-
an image sensor array for converting light from a target into output signals representative thereof, the image sensor array having a centerline; a processor for decoding a machine readable symbology within the target derived from the output signals; receive optics for directing light from the target to the image sensor, the optics having a receive optics optical axis; the image sensor array and receive optics being disposed within a head portion of the optical reader, the head portion defining a medial plane wherein an operator holds the head portion such that the medial plane of the head portion is approximately normal to the target plane, wherein the image sensor array and receive optics are configured such that the centerline is not coincident with any part of the optical axis at the time that the receive optic is directing light from the target to the image senor to thereby reduce specular reflection into the image sensor when the operator holds the medial plane approximately normal to the target plane.
